Explore Taipei’s Iconic Attractions on Wednesday
🌟 Taipei, the bustling capital of Taiwan, offers a myriad of exciting activities for travelers visiting on a Wednesday. One of the best ways to start your day is by visiting the iconic Taipei 101. Standing at 508 meters, Taipei 101 was once the tallest building in the world and remains a marvel of eco-friendly architecture. Take the lightning-fast elevator to the observatory on the 89th floor for a panoramic view of the city.
Another must-visit site is the Chiang Kai-shek Memorial Hall. Known for its grand architecture and historical significance, the area surrounding the hall offers a tranquil setting for reflection. It’s particularly wonderful to explore in the morning when the grounds are peaceful and filled with locals practicing tai chi.

Dive into Taipei’s Cultural Gems on Wednesday Afternoon
🎨 In the afternoon, immerse yourself in Taipei’s rich cultural heritage by visiting some of its renowned museums. The National Palace Museum is a treasure trove of Chinese art and history. With a vast collection that spans over several centuries, it’s the perfect place to spend a few enlightening hours.
Afterward, head over to the Songshan Cultural and Creative Park. This location is a hub for artists and designers, providing an excellent insight into Taiwan’s burgeoning creative industry. The park often hosts exhibitions and events featuring local artists, making it a lively place to explore.

Experience Local Flavors at Taipei’s Night Markets
🍜 As the day transitions into evening, it’s time to dive into one of Taipei’s most exciting culinary experiences: the night markets. On a Wednesday, let the Raohe Night Market beckon with its vibrant energy and mouth-watering street food offerings. This market is known for its famed pepper buns and a wide array of local Taiwanese snacks.
Visit the Shilin Night Market, which is not only the largest but also one of the most popular night markets in Taipei. It’s an ideal place to sample local delicacies such as bubble tea, oyster omelets, and stinky tofu.

Relax with Nature and Spiritual Sites
🌿 If you seek a more serene end to your Wednesday, consider visiting Taipei’s natural and spiritual havens. The Elephant Mountain trail offers a short hike with spectacular views of the city skyline, including Taipei 101. It’s a refreshing escape from the urban hustle.
Visiting temples like the Longshan Temple can also be a rewarding experience, offering insights into local religious practices and traditional architecture. Many temples hold evening ceremonies that are both visually and spiritually captivating.
